MPC17511EP Description

MPC17511EP Description

The MPC17511EP is a highly integrated power management IC (PMIC) designed for driving bipolar stepper motors and brushed DC motors. Manufactured by NXP Semiconductors, this device is tailored for battery-powered applications, offering a robust solution for motor control in compact and energy-efficient systems. The MPC17511EP features a half-bridge output configuration with a maximum current output of 1A, making it suitable for driving motors with a supply voltage range of 2.7V to 5.7V. The load voltage range is 2V to 6.8V, ensuring compatibility with a wide range of motor types and operating conditions.

MPC17511EP Features

  • Output Current Capability: The MPC17511EP can deliver up to 1A of current, providing sufficient power for a variety of motor applications.
  • Output Configuration: The half-bridge (2) configuration allows for efficient control of bipolar stepper motors and brushed DC motors, offering precise control and high performance.
  • Voltage Range: With a supply voltage range of 2.7V to 5.7V and a load voltage range of 2V to 6.8V, the MPC17511EP is versatile and can be used in a wide range of applications, including battery-powered devices.
  • Technology: Utilizing CMOS technology, the MPC17511EP ensures low power consumption and high efficiency, which is crucial for battery-operated systems.
  • Compliance: The device is REACH unaffected and RoHS3 compliant, ensuring it meets the latest environmental and safety standards.
  • Moisture Sensitivity Level: MSL 2 (1 Year) indicates that the MPC17511EP is suitable for use in environments with moderate humidity levels, providing reliability and durability.
  • Mounting Type: The surface mount package (24QFN) allows for easy integration into compact designs, making it ideal for space-constrained applications.
  • Interface: The parallel interface ensures fast and reliable communication, enhancing the overall performance of the motor control system.
